Overview
Ronald Scheff is an Oncologist in New York, New York. Dr. Scheff is highly rated in 15 conditions, according to our data. His top areas of expertise are Squamous Cell Lung Carcinoma, Lung Cancer, Small Cell Lung Cancer (SCLC), and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er (NSCLC).
His clinical research consists of co-authoring 14 peer reviewed articles and participating in 6 clinical trials. MediFind looks at clinical research from the past 15 years.
